Professor Iraê Amaral Guerrini

He holds a degree in Forestry Engineering from the Escola Superior de Agricultura Luiz de Queiroz (ESALQ), University of São Paulo (USP) (1978), a master’s degree in Soil and Plant Nutrition from ESALQ/USP (1983), a PhD in Soil and Plant Nutrition from ESALQ/USP (1990), and a Livre-Docência in Fertilizers and Amendments from the Faculty of Agricultural Sciences (FCA), São Paulo State University (UNESP) (2003).

In 2006, he created and served as the Coordinator of the Graduate Program in Forest Science at FCA/UNESP from June 2007 to June 2010, and was reappointed from June 2010 to June 2013. He again took on the role of Coordinator for this program from November 2014 to May 2017.

He is currently the coordinator of international agreements between UNESP and CIRAD (Centre de Coopération Internationale de Recherche Agronomique pour le Développement) in Montpellier, France; INISS (Università degli Studi di Sassari) in Sardinia, Italy; IPC (Instituto Politécnico de Coimbra) in Coimbra, Portugal; and unofficial agreements with the University of Washington in Seattle, WA, USA, and TUAT (Tokyo University of Agriculture and Technology) in Tokyo, Japan. Additionally, he coordinates official agreements with INPA (Instituto de Pesquisas da Amazônia) in Manaus, AM, and UFCG (Universidade Federal de Campina Grande) in Patos, PB.

Alessandro Zabotto

Specializing in ESG and Carbon Markets, he is a biologist with a specialization in Environmental Education, and holds a Master’s and PhD in Agronomy from UNESP, Botucatu, SP. His academic background includes extracurricular experiences both in Brazil and abroad, providing a solid theoretical and practical foundation in his field.

In recent years, he has distinguished himself as a leader of expeditions in the Amazon, conducting surveys of fauna and flora to characterize biodiversity and quantify carbon. Additionally, he has developed and implemented socio-environmental projects focused on forest conservation and sustainable development for local communities.

As an ESG consultant, he has extensive experience in designing projects that integrate social and environmental practices into business strategies, balancing social investments and environmental preservation with positive financial outcomes. His contributions include the preparation of ESG audit reports and support for the implementation of best practices in various organizations.

He is also one of the coordinators of the Federal Government project "Green and Resilient Cities," collaborating with the Ministry of the Environment on the development of policies and actions that promote more sustainable and climate-resilient cities.

Dr. Fernando Albino

A lawyer and former director of the CVM (Securities and Exchange Commission), he is a professor and specialist in carbon credit and environmental assets. He also leads Ieje (Institute of Legal and Economic Studies).
